Lauren Roberts made history on Saturday night. She became the first woman to win a USPO event, taking down Event #3 for $218,400. Roberts beat a stacked final table and battled back from being one of the shortest stacks to earn her first career title and best live cash. On

Seth Davies vs. Stephen Chidwick
Stephen Chidwick limped in for 24,000 and Seth Davies checked from the button. The flop landed [8cJsKs] and both players checked to reveal the [Qd] on the turn. Chidwick led out for 72,000 and Davies called as the river landed the [Ad]. Chidwick checked, Davies bet 108,000, and Chidwick folded.

Sean Winter Eliminated by Stephen Chidwick
Larry Wight limped in and Stephen Chidwick raised to 250,000. Sean Winter called all in for 145,000 from the cutoff, and Wright folded. Chidwick: [JsTs] Winter: [AcKc] The board ran out [8d6h9dQh7c] and Chidwick's straight sent Winter to the rail.
Stephen Chidwick Continues to Chip Up
Joelle Parenteau limped in from first to act and Stephen Chidwick called in middle position as Kristen Bicknell checked her option on the button. The flop landed [8cJdQd] and action checked through to reveal the [As] on the turn. Chidwick bet 20,000, and both Bicknell and Parenteau folded.
